Published as plates v, vi and vii in dr. Gustav adolph kenngott’s “naturgeschichte des mineralreichs für schule und haus,” these chromolithographed plates combine scientific mineralogical study with exceptionally attractive color and graphic composition. Plate v is devoted largely to quartz and silica minerals, including smoky quartz crystals, amethyst quartz, rock crystal, heliotrope, jasper and varieties of chalcedony. Plate vi features richly patterned agates and ornamental stones, including chalcedony, fortification agate, moss agate, chrysoprase, onyx, banded agate and opal. Plate vii illustrates tourmaline and associated minerals, including rubellite, green tourmaline, sapphire, augite, diopside, amphibole, serpentine and related specimens. Together the three sheets form a particularly attractive mineralogical group, combining crystalline forms, cut stones and large natural mineral specimens in subdued yet rich late 19th-century coloring. These are original antique prints published in 1888, not modern reproductions. Author / editor: dr.
